Who makes the engines for Cfmoto?

KTM
Yes, CFMoto is one of the production partners of KTM. The Chinese company will solely be making the 799cc parallel-twin LC8 motor that will power the 790 Duke from 2020.

Is the CFMOTO wk650tr a twin?

CFMoto WK650TR review August 16, 2013 Yes, you’re right, the WK650TR bears an uncanny resemblance to Honda’s ST1300, but this isn’t a shaft-driven V4 über-tourer. It’s a 650 water-cooled parallel twin and one of the first middle-weight tourers to arrive from China.

Is the wk650tr made in the UK?

Copy, learn, make good, expand. The WK650TR is only labelled thus in the UK. In the rest of the world it’s known as a CF Moto 650TR and CF Moto are notable as a Chinese manufacturer, in that 25% of their not inconsiderable workforce concentrates on R&D.
